About us


Avencia Consulting are working with a specialty Insurer based in the City who are looking for a Political Risk Underwriter to join.

The Company currently writes lines of business including; speciality insurance: aviation & aerospace, energy, marine, property, credit & political risk, and other speciality; reinsurance: property reinsurance, property retrocession, speciality reinsurance,whole account/multi-class.


The role


Reporting to the Head of Credit and Political Risk, the primary purpose of the role is to assist in originating, modelling, administering, and underwriting a portfolio of (re)insurance business.

This includes analysing and maintaining the accuracy of all(re)insurance submission data, policies, and records with the ultimate goal of ensuring that interests are properly managed and protected.


Key accountabilities

  • Participate in the underwriting process, evaluation, and presentation of submissions, analysing and interpreting exposures, determining coverage and contract language
  • Working cross class, predominantly CF and PRI, but may need to work across PF and Structured Credit or other Bespoke lines when needed
  • Assist and work with risk modeling and pricing tools
  • Presentation of risks on the Underwriting Call
  • Originate, leverage, build and maintain broker and client relationships
  • Monitor market developments and remain current regarding knowledge of all relevant classes of business, and legislated and regulatory changes / requirements
  • Ensure accuracy and integrity of underwriting data in group underwriting systems
  • Prepare and issue quotes on an accurate and timely basis
  • Supervising and/or mentoring junior members of the team
  • Ensure compliance with internal and external underwriting regulations, liaising as appropriate with external bodies such as brokers, clients, auditors and regulators as required
  • Assist with strategic initiatives as needed to promote business growth

Skills & experience

  • Minimum of 5 years' experience in a broking or underwriting capacity in the relevant line of business
  • Established networks and strong existing relationships with brokers and clients, and ability to independently manage meetings
  • Strong understanding of the underwriting marketplace
  • Excellent analytical skills, with a working knowledge of and ability to interpret the outputs of pricing models, and the statistical skills necessary to perform analyses on first principles
  • Proven negotiator, with demonstrated ability to attract new business and retain clients
